The years axe passed, we face a new tomorrow, Another dawn As yet unmarked by ecstasy or sorrow It beckons on — The challenge calls, we hasten on to greet it, Our arms flung wide, What more of life than given chance to meet it, And fate decide? For time is fleet, and hopes within us burning Brook no delay, So little time and none of it for yearning, For waits the day. Yet memory weaves the silken thread that binds us For dreams remain And joys recalled in wistful tones remind us, Return again . . . So part endures, the heart was made for sharing Lament no tears Hold fast instead the wondrous gift of caring Through all the years. Mary Rix 15
